A-frames, with their steep, triangular roofs and classic cabin feel, are re-emerging as popular vacation homes and even year-round residences. Although this architectural style saw its heyday in the 1950s and 60s, modern design trends are bringing A-frames back to life, driven by a mix of nostalgia, sustainability, and versatility
Nostalgia Meets Modern Aesthetics
For many, A-frames evoke memories of cozy cabins nestled in nature, offering a rustic escape from urban life. Today’s homebuyers are drawn to that nostalgia, yet modern A-frames come with a contemporary twist Clean lines, minimalist interiors, and large windows are popular upgrades, merging the retro A-frame style with a chic, updated look. This blend of old and new design appeals to those seeking a unique yet timeless space
